Pendas : Jurnah Ilmiah Pendidikan Dasar is a journal published twice a year, namely in June and December that aims to be a forum for scientific publications to pour ideas and studies complemented with the results of research related to primary school education. To achieve this, basic education journals will selectively disseminate ideas and studies complemented by quality research results related to basic education, develop an education center to the elementary-school that can produce innovative, creative and original work and tested in the field of education and learning elementary School to be disseminated and implemented for improving the quality of primary-to-national education at the national, regional and international levels.

EFEKTIVITAS MEDIA UTAR (ULAR TANGGA PINTAR) TERHADAP HASIL BELAJAR IPAS SISWA KELAS V SDN RANTAU KANAN 1 Maharani, Delinda Puspita; Adawiyah, Rabiatul

Abstract

Pembelajaran Ilmu Pengetahuan Alam dan Sosial (IPAS) di SDN Rantau Kanan 1 masih didominasi metode konvensional dan PowerPoint sederhana sehingga keterlibatan siswa terbatas dan hasil belajar belum optimal, khususnya pada materi sistem pernapasan manusia. Penelitian ini bertujuan menguji efektivitas media Ular Tangga Pintar (UTAR) terhadap hasil belajar IPAS siswa kelas V serta mendeskripsikan respons siswa dan guru. Penelitian menggunakan pendekatan kuantitatif dengan desain kuasi eksperimen nonequivalent control group. Sampel jenuh berjumlah 34 siswa, terdiri atas 20 siswa kelas VA sebagai kelompok eksperimen dan 14 siswa kelas VB sebagai kelompok kontrol. Data dikumpulkan melalui tes awal dan tes akhir sebanyak 10 soal, lembar observasi afektif, serta angket respons berskala Guttman. Analisis data meliputi uji normalitas Shapiro-Wilk, uji homogenitas Levene, uji t sampel independen, dan N-Gain. Data berdistribusi normal dan homogen. Uji t menunjukkan perbedaan hasil belajar yang signifikan antarkelompok (p < 0,001). Kelompok eksperimen memperoleh rata-rata N-Gain 0,6183 atau 61,83% dengan kategori sedang dan cukup efektif, sedangkan kelompok kontrol memperoleh 0,2476 atau 24,76%. Skor afektif kelompok eksperimen (4,09) lebih tinggi daripada kelompok kontrol (3,91), sementara siswa dan guru memberikan respons positif sebesar 100%. Dengan demikian, UTAR cukup efektif meningkatkan hasil belajar kognitif sekaligus mendukung kerja sama, tanggung jawab, dan kejujuran siswa.

Abstract

This study aimed to examine the implementation of the Project Based Learning model to improve learning outcomes on fraction material among Grade II students of SD Inpres Kolongan Atas Sonder. The method used was Classroom Action Research, consisting of planning, action, observation, and reflection stages. Prior to the intervention, students’ learning completeness was very low. After the implementation of the Project Based Learning model, learning outcomes improved significantly. The model also fostered 21st-century skills 4C, students demonstrated critical thinking when determining how to divide an object into equal parts, creativity in designing and coloring the “Fraction Pizza Painting” media, collaboration while working in groups, and communication when presenting their project results. This is evidenced by a learning achievement rate of 83.3% with an average score of 80.96. It can be concluded that the Project Based Learning model is effective in improving learning outcomes on fraction material among Grade II students at SD Inpres Kolongan Atas Sonder.

Abstract

This research aims to analyse the aggressive behaviour of students in class X of SMA Negeri 1 Pantai Labu Ajaran Year 2025/2026. This research uses a quantitative approach with a type of experimental research (pre-experimental design) through one group pre-test post-test design. The population in the study was 180 students, and the sample was taken by purposive sampling of 10 students who had a high level of aggressive behaviour. The instrument used is a questionnaire, and supported by observation, interview, and documentation. Data analysis was carried out by comparing pre-test and post-test scores to determine the changes in the level of aggressive behaviour after treatment and with the help of the SPSS program version 26.00 for windows. The results of the data analysis in the study showed a significance value (2-tailed) of 0.000 and a t-test value of 8.687, which showed that group guidance services for modelling techniques had a significant effect on the decrease in aggressive behaviour. Thus, it can be concluded that through group guidance services, modelling techniques give influence to students' aggressive behaviour to undergo changes.

Abstract

Critical thinking skills are among the skills that need to be developed in mathematics education; however, these skills remain relatively low among elementary school students, particularly when solving addition and subtraction word problems. This study aims to determine the effect of implementing the Realistic Mathematics Education (RME) method on students’ critical thinking skills in addition and subtraction topics in third grade at SDN 3 Simpen. The study employed a quantitative approach using a quasi-experimental method with a one-group pretest-posttest design. The research subjects consisted of 31 third-grade students at SDN 3 Simpen during the 2025/2026 school year. Data were collected using critical thinking ability tests in the form of pretests and posttests, which were then analyzed through normality tests and hypothesis testing. The results of the study show that students’ average critical thinking scores increased from 28.226 on the pretest to 81.855 on the posttest. The normality test results indicated that the data were not normally distributed; therefore, hypothesis testing was conducted using the Mann–Whitney test. The test results indicate that H₀ was rejected and Hₐ was accepted, meaning that the implementation of the Realistic Mathematics Education method has an effect on students’ critical thinking skills in addition and subtraction. Thus, the Realistic Mathematics Education method can serve as an effective alternative teaching method to improve the critical thinking skills of elementary school students.

Abstract

This study aims to describe the implementation of audiovisual media in teaching Banjar language speaking skills to fifth-grade students at SDN 3 Kapar, the students' responses to the use of such media, and the challenges teachers face in applying audiovisual media to Banjar language instruction. It is a qualitative study employing a descriptive approach, utilizing observation, interviews, and documentation for data collection. Data analysis involved the stages of data reduction, data presentation, and conclusion drawing. The results indicate that the use of audiovisual media supported the learning process for the fifth-grade students at SDN 3 Kapar. Students responded positively to the audiovisual media, as the lessons became more engaging and easier to comprehend, while also boosting student participation and confidence in speaking the Banjar language. Nine students achieved a score of 5 (excellent), and four students achieved a score of 4 (good). Challenges encountered during implementation included limited supporting facilities, varying levels of student proficiency in the Banjar language, and the use of languages ​​other than Banjar in the students' environment.

Abstract

Abstrak This Research examines the relationships among brand trust, brand experience, brand equity, and brand love within Indonesia’s automotive industry, based on responses from 374 consumers across five regions of Jakarta. Grounded in the Customer-Based Brand Equity (CBBE) framework and emotional branding theory, the study analyzes both direct and mediating effects of brand trust and brand experience on brand love, with brand equity as the mediating variable. Employing a quantitative, causal, and cross-sectional design under a post-positivist paradigm, data were collected through a validated 4-point Likert scale questionnaire and analyzed using Partial Least Squares Structural Equation Modeling (PLS-SEM) via SmartPLS. The constructs measured include brand trust (credibility, transparency, consistency, reputation), brand experience (sensory, affective, cognitive, behavioral), brand equity (awareness, association, perceived quality), and brand love (attachment, identification, loyalty, advocacy). Findings reveal that brand trust and brand experience significantly and positively influence brand equity and brand love. Moreover, brand equity partially mediates these relationships, demonstrating its crucial role in translating trust and experiential perceptions into emotional attachment. The model showed strong reliability and validity (Cronbach’s α > 0.80, AVE > 0.50, CR > 0.85)..

Abstract

This study aims to improve students' conceptual understanding of light and its properties through the application of the Experiential Learning model in Grade V at UPTD SD Negeri 5 Juli. This research is a Classroom Action Research (CAR) conducted in two cycles, comprising planning, acting, observing, and reflecting stages. The subjects consisted of 24 students. Data were collected using written test instruments, teacher and student activity observation sheets, and student response questionnaires.The results showed a consistent graph of improvement in learning quality. In Cycle I Action 1, the teacher activity percentage was 84.28% and student activity was 85.56%, which increased in Action 2 to 86% for teacher activity and 86% for student activity. Meanwhile, in Cycle II Action 1, teacher activity reached 90% and student activity was 89.28%, further increasing in Action 2 to 95.33% for teacher activity and 92.66% for student activity, both categorized as excellent. Regarding the classical mastery of conceptual understanding, Cycle I only reached 54.17% (13 out of 24 students). Following improvements in Cycle II, a significant increase occurred, with classical mastery reaching 91.7% (22 out of 24 students). These results prove that the predetermined success indicator of 80% was exceeded. Based on these findings, it can be concluded that the implementation of the Experiential Learning model is effective in enhancing Grade V students conceptual understanding of light and its properties in IPAS at UPTD SD Negeri 5 Juli.

Abstract

Mathematics learning in elementary schools continues to face various challenges, particularly because many mathematical concepts are abstract and difficult for students to understand. Observations conducted in Grade III Bilal bin Rabbah at Muhammadiyah Sang Pencerah Elementary School, Metro City, revealed that students perceive mathematics as a difficult and uninteresting subject and that existing learning media are insufficient to help them understand mathematical concepts concretely. This study aims to develop an interactive mathematics storybook as a learning medium for the topic of length measurement and to determine the validity and practicality of the developed product. The study employed a Research and Development (R&D) approach using the ADDIE development model, which consists of Analysis, Design, Development, Implementation, and Evaluation. The product was created using Canva as an illustrated storybook equipped with interactive activities, simple challenges, and QR codes linking to instructional videos. The results showed that the developed interactive mathematics storybook achieved an average validation score of 83% (highly valid), consisting of 81% from material experts, 84% from media experts, and 86% from language experts. Furthermore, the practicality test yielded scores of 90% from teachers and 96% from students (highly practical). These findings indicate that the product meets criteria for content validity, media design, language quality, and ease of use, making it suitable and practical for elementary mathematics instruction. Abstract

Mathematics instruction requires teaching models and media that can actively engage students so that the concepts being taught can be better understood. This study aims to improve student learning outcomes on the characteristics of triangles through the application of a Game-Based Learning (GBL) model supported by the “Snakes and Ladders: Exploring Science” (UT-JI) media. This study employed the Classroom Action Research (CAR) method based on the Kemmis and McTaggart model, conducted in two cycles, preceded by a pre-cycle phase. The research subjects were 24 fifth-grade students in Class V B at Al Azhar 25 Islamic Elementary School in Semarang. Data were collected through tests, observations, and documentation, and then analyzed using quantitative and qualitative descriptive analysis. The results of the study show that the percentage of students achieving mastery increased from 33.33% in the pre-cycle—with an average score of 61.45—to 66.67% in Cycle I—with an average score of 73.75—and further increased to 91.67% in Cycle II—with an average score of 89.58. The results indicate that the implementation of a Game-Based Learning model using the “Snakes and Ladders: Exploring Science” (UT-JI) media is effective in improving student learning outcomes on the characteristics of triangles in Grade 5B at Al Azhar 25 Islamic Elementary School in Semarang.

Abstract

Education is a conscious and planned effort to create a conducive learning environment so that students can actively develop their abilities and potential. One important aspect in shaping a person's character is the level of faith, and religiosity is reflected not only in the performance of worship but also in a person's spiritual experience and in how religious values are applied in daily social life. Although SMAN 20 Jakarta Pusat has established the Rohani Islam (ROHIS) organization as a forum for religious guidance, there has been no specific study analyzing the role of ROHIS in influencing students' religious attitudes from three main aspects, namely the practice, experience, and consequence dimensions. This study applied a qualitative approach with a descriptive method designed in the form of a case study. Data were collected through observation, interviews, and documentation involving seven informants, namely the ROHIS advisor, the ROHIS chairperson, four active ROHIS members, and an Islamic Education teacher, and were analyzed using the Miles, Huberman, and Saldana model consisting of data collection, data condensation, data display, and conclusion drawing and verification. The results show that ROHIS plays an important role in improving students' religiosity at SMA Negeri 20 Jakarta Pusat through guidance in the practice, experience, and consequence dimensions. These three dimensions developed in an integrated manner through sustainable ROHIS programs, supported by the exemplary conduct of advisors and administrators as well as the active involvement of all members.
